How I escaped gunshots during Ekiti bye-election - Senator
Nigeria, March 22 -- The senator representing Ekiti South district, Abiodun Olujimi, has narrated how she escaped being shot during the violence that erupted at the House of Assembly bye-election for Ekiti East Constituency 1 on Saturday.
The bye-election was to fill in the vacant position of Juwa Adegbuyi, a representative of the constituency, who died in February.
Mrs Olujimi, a member of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), said the incident occurred shortly after the visit of some All Progressives Congress (APC) members at the polling unit.
PREMIUM TIMES reported how two people died in the incident at ward 7, Unit 7 Iworo in Omuo Ekiti.
